Output 289b335c125c9c756e3783000124be0b73ef1cb8b0661ac63a835a2b592b7066:0

value
246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bb603043d1383b194ab65e004e74b81732504f OP_EQUAL
address
3CEx6hUYvrphJfesvqrgpK3rruL6w945g6
transaction
289b335c125c9c756e3783000124be0b73ef1cb8b0661ac63a835a2b592b7066
spent
true